Paul Day says ‘I disappear with the flow’ as critics inquire of if artists monument in Moscow square will reflect reality of Karimov’s bloody ruleThe late president of Uzbekistan,Islam Karimov, was widely regarded as one of the most ruthless dictators in recent history. His regime jailed and tortured critics, and massacred hundreds of unarmed protesters in the town of Andijan in 2005.
Despite his reputation,a leading British sculptor is working on a memorial in Moscow to Karimov, who died final year after a 27-year rule over Uzbekistan. Related: Islam Karimov obituary Continue reading...
